Job Purpose and Impact
The Graphic Designer will be responsible for the graphic support of the department. In this role, you will coordinate, integrate and implement the creative and innovative ideas that meet specific customer need and contribute to the design of the Leman collections & customized B2B projects or concepts from A to Z.
Key Accountabilities
Apply strong conception to translate the concepts into perfect design and print-ready files.
Solicit, collect, organize and translate a briefing into a graphic concept, and maintain photo database to ensure it is always fully up-to-date.
Independently photograph new products and edit photos in Photoshop.
Provide assistance and training to lower-level employees.
Handle complex clerical, administrative, technical or customer support issues under minimal supervision, while escalating only the most complex issues to appropriate staff.
Other duties as assigned
